Most people join a union because they want protection at work – help with pay and conditions of service, legal or health and safety advice or representation in case things go wrong at work. That’s what we’re here for.  UNISON negotiates on pay and working conditions at every level – local, regional and national.

Membership Rates

Membership costs in England, Scotland and Wales/Cymru

Annual SalaryMonthly Cost
Up to £2,000£1.30
£2,001 – £5,000£3.50
£5,001 – £8,000£5.30
£8,001 – £11,000£6.60
£11,001 – £14,000£7.85
£14,001 – £17,000£9.70
£17,001 – £20,000£11.50
£20,001 – £25,000£14.00
£25,001 – £30,000£17.25
Over £35,000£22.50
